GREENHAYES - streets of Chipping Sodbury (England).
Explore "GREENHAYES" on the map of Chipping Sodbury in street view mode
Click on the buttons below to display the map of GREENHAYES, Chipping Sodbury, United Kingdom
Search street by name:
Tags:
GREENHAYES on the map of Chipping Sodbury,
Chipping Sodbury satellite view, Chipping Sodbury street view.
Source: Ordnance Survey Open Data